A wick that is oversized for the lamp will consume fuel too quickly, causing excessive smoking, sooting, and even posing a fire risk as the flame climbs the sides of the chimney. Understanding the role of oil lamp wicks is fundamental to appreciating the timeless craft of illumination.
The wick is the silent conductor, drawing fuel upward through capillary action to feed the flame. Once the oil reaches the top, the heat of the flame vaporizes the fuel, creating a continuous cycle of combustion.
